I've hosted a lot of live drafts and auctions during the last 13 years, and I've participated in a lot of live drafts and auctions during my 27 years in this industry, but I don't think I've ever seen a more intense first hour of bidding like I saw yesterday in the $1300 AL Auction League. This one lived up to its advance billing!! 8-)

Wow, you had 12 good owners who were throwing players out at high prices and then like piranhas the rest just took to the carcass and chewed away. It was like "Carlos Correa at 36." Then 37, 38, 39, 40, 41, 42. Next. "Mike Trout for $35". 36, 37, 38, 39, 40, 41, 42, 43 rapid fire just like that. And that continued for one full hour with everyone leaving with some players. You either dove in or you were left without any star players. It was a fantastic start to an auction.
